• Uses and gratifications research helps in finding out how audience makes use of
    mass media to gratify their needs. Media research can help both the industry and
    the academia to map audience behaviour which is very much connected to various
    factors such as geography, culture, education and socio-economic circumstances.
    This research conducted among students reveals that students make use of the
    Internet primarily with an entertainment motive, and only secondarily for education
    and current affairs knowledge. The study also reveals that digital divide is widely
    prevalent and it is an important issue to be looked at especially in terms of
    gender, though the digital divide has been narrowing among students in terms of
    geography.
